参麦注射液对慢性再生障碍性贫血患者血清肿瘤坏死因子及骨髓CD_(34)^+细胞凋亡的影响 被引量:7

摘要 目的:探讨参麦注射液治疗慢性再生障碍性贫血(chronicaplasticanemia,CAA)的疗效及其作用机制。方法:将65例CAA患者随机分为治疗组和对照组,治疗组采用参麦注射液配合西药常规治疗,对照组单用西药治疗,治疗后进行疗效评价,并分别于治疗前后检测患者血清肿瘤坏死因子(tumornecrosisfactor-α,TNF-α)水平,以及采用免疫磁珠分离系统(MACS)分离纯化骨髓CD34+细胞,用DNA末端原位标记(TUNEL)技术分析骨髓CD34+细胞原位凋亡状况。结果:治疗组总有效率为63.6%,对照组总有效率为40.6%,治疗组疗效明显优于对照组(P<0.01);治疗前,CAA患者血清TNF-α浓度、骨髓CD34+细胞凋亡率均明显高于健康对照组(P<0.01),治疗后,治疗组血清TNF-α浓度明显降低(P<0.01),骨髓CD34+细胞凋亡率减低(P<0.05),与对照组相比均有显著差异(尸<0.05)。结论:参麦注射液治疗CAA疗效确切,其机制可能为降低CAA患者血清TNE-α浓度,减少骨髓CD34+细胞凋亡。 Objective: To investigate the effect of Shenmai injection on chronic aplastic anemia patients and its mechanism. Method: Sixty-five chronic aplastic anemia patients were randomized into treatment group and control group. The patients of the treatment group were treated by injecting Shenmai injection and taking western medicine orally, those of the control group taking western medicine orally only, then the effect was evaluated. The concentration of tumor necrosis factor-α(TNF-α) in blood serum was detected and the apoptosis of bone marrow CD34+ cell was analysed by DNA ISEL technic before and after treatment. Result: The effective rate of the treatment group and the control group was 63.6% and 40.6% respectively, the effect of the Shenmai injection on the treatment group was obviously better than that of the control group (P〈0.01). Before treatment, the concentration of TNF-α in blood serum and the apoptosis rate of bone marrow CD^34+ cell of the chronic aplastic anemia patient were higher than normal ( P〈0.01 ). After treatment, the concentration of TNF-α in blood serum of the treatment group decreased obviously( P〈0.01 ), and the apoptosis rate of bone marrow CD34^+ cell of the treatment group also decreased ( P〈0.05), which had significant difference compared with those of the control group( P〈0.05). Conclusion: Shenmai injection is efficient to chronic aplastic anemia. The mechanism is decreasing the concentration of TNF-α in blood serum and the apoptosis rate of bone marrow CD34^+ cell.
